Meaning
Wind generators, or wind turbines, harness wind energy to produce electricity. They consist of rotor blades, a generator, and a tower, capturing kinetic energy from the wind and converting it into electrical power through rotational motion.

Market Restraints
- Intermittency Issues: Variability in wind availability affecting grid stability and necessitating backup power sources or energy storage solutions.
- Infrastructure Challenges: High upfront costs, land acquisition, permitting delays, and grid connection issues hindering wind power project development.
- Public Opposition: Concerns over visual impacts, noise pollution, and environmental impacts on wildlife affecting wind farm approvals and expansions.
- Technological Limitations: Limits in turbine size, efficiency improvements, and offshore deployment challenges impacting market growth.

Competitive Landscape
Key players in the wind generators sales market include:
- Vestas Wind Systems
- Siemens Gamesa Renewable Energy
- General Electric (GE) Renewable Energy
- Goldwind
- Nordex Group
Competitive strategies focus on technology leadership, product innovation, market diversification, and strategic partnerships to gain a competitive edge and expand market presence globally.
Segmentation
The wind generators sales market can be segmented based on:
- Turbine Type: Onshore Wind Turbines, Offshore Wind Turbines.
- Capacity: Small (โค 1 MW), Medium (1-3 MW), Large (> 3 MW).
- Application: Utility-Scale, Distributed Generation, Residential.
